He used to be a good cop with a minor drinking habit. Now he’s a private eye with a major habit for getting into trouble. Operating from a pub, he has to face his demons every day. Still reeling from the global economic crisis, Galway offers the perfect backdrop for criminal activity. And for those untouched by the economic downfall, there’s still enough criminal energy fermenting since the 60s and 70s, when the traditional social and political fabric of Ireland came apart, leaving rifts that still plague the country today. Taylor’s cases reflect these upheavals, and lead him to the very abyss of human malevolence and evil...
